POCATELLO — For those who have endured the heartbreak of losing a baby, a soft light will soon shine in their honor. For the first time, Pocatello will join communities around the world in honoring babies lost much too soon through the global Wave of Light event.
Each year on October 15, families light candles at 7 p.m. local time to mark Pregnancy and Infant Loss Remembrance Day, creating a continuous 24-hour wave of light across time zones.
The annual vigil brings comfort to families who have experienced miscarriage, stillbirth, SIDS, or infant death—and this year, Portneuf Medical Center is helping bring that light to Pocatello.
Portneuf Medical Center invites the community to take part in its first Wave of Light event on Wednesday, October 15, at the Portneuf Wellness Complex.
